Briefly see below: Depends on theoretical orientation, but briefly... We learn how friendly or unfriendly our environment is early in life. We learn how to cope with the environment when we're young. Depending on what happened during those tender years, the way we learn how to relate, communicate, cope with things transcends into adulthood. If something is amiss, this might lead to depression.
